Maintenance and tune-ups are like annual checkups for your mower – they prevent those Saturday morning surprises. A good tune-up includes fresh oil, clean air filters, spark plug inspection, belt adjustments, and deck leveling. Think of it as preventive medicine that saves you money and headaches down the road.

Don’t underestimate blade sharpening – those dull blades aren’t just giving your grass a bad haircut. They’re making your engine work harder and actually weakening your lawn by creating ragged cuts. Professional sharpening brings back that clean slice that keeps both your mower and your grass happy.

Residential vs Commercial Lawn Mower Services Near Me

The difference between residential and commercial lawn mower services near me is like comparing a family car to a delivery truck – they’re both vehicles, but they face completely different demands.

Homeowners typically use walk-behind mowers, riding mowers, or small tractors on weekends and evenings. Your equipment gets a workout during growing season but rests plenty between uses. Residential services focus on annual maintenance or service every 25-50 operating hours, with convenient scheduling that works around your life.

Landscaping crews and property managers push their equipment hard every single day. Commercial mowers face intensive use that demands frequent maintenance and specialized knowledge of heavy-duty components. These services often include preventive maintenance programs and priority scheduling because downtime costs money.

Equipment size makes a huge difference in service complexity. Your walk-behind mower needs basic care, while commercial zero-turn mowers require hydraulic system service, complex transmission work, and commercial-grade engine expertise.

Warranty compliance becomes critical with newer equipment. Professional service providers maintain manufacturer certifications and use approved parts, protecting your investment and keeping warranties valid.

Preparing Your Mower for Drop-Off or On-Site Visit

Proper preparation ensures efficient service and helps technicians quickly identify and address problems with your equipment.

Fuel Drain Procedures vary by service type. For shop drop-off, most providers prefer you drain the fuel tank to prevent spills during transport. Mobile services typically handle fuel-related preparations on-site, but confirm requirements when scheduling.

Debris Removal significantly speeds diagnosis and repair. Clean grass clippings, leaves, and dirt from the deck, engine cooling fins, and air intake areas. This cleaning allows technicians to immediately assess mechanical components without spending billable time on basic cleaning.

Access Preparation for mobile services requires ensuring technicians can reach your equipment and have necessary utilities available. Provide clear driveway or yard access and confirm availability of electrical outlets and water sources if needed for cleaning or testing.

Issue Documentation helps technicians understand problems before they arrive. Take photos of visible damage, note specific symptoms like unusual noises or performance issues, and document when problems first appeared. This information guides diagnostic procedures and can reduce service time.

What Does It Cost? Average Pricing & Value Adds

When you start Googling lawn mower services near me, it helps to know what a fair invoice looks like so you can weigh repair vs. replacement. Costs swing with your zip code, mower size, and the exact fix, but the ball-park figures below come from broad internet research.

Basic tune-ups—oil, air filter, spark plug, and minor adjustments—usually land between $35 and $120 for walk-behind units. Riding and commercial machines cost more because there is simply more hardware to service.

All prices listed are average ranges pulled from publicly available data and are not MAS Landscaping and Snow Removal rates.

Mobile repair starts around $120 for the first visit (travel + diagnostics). Hourly labor often runs about $120 after that. For a quick carb clean or belt swap, bringing the shop to your driveway can still beat the hassle of loading a 500-lb mower onto a trailer.

Blade sharpening ($15–$40 per blade) is a tiny line item that delivers big results—cleaner cuts and less engine strain.

Emergency or after-hours calls may tack on 25–50 % but keep your yard from turning into a jungle when the mower quits mid-season.

Savvy owners ask about package deals or maintenance plans that bundle spring and fall service and often shave 10–20 % off one-off pricing.

Detailed infographic comparing costs and services across different types of lawn mower maintenance packages - lawn mower services near me infographic

Service Type Walk-Behind Mowers Riding Mowers Commercial Equipment
Basic Tune-up $35–$120 $75–$225 $150–$450
Mobile Service Call $120–$180 $120–$360 $180–$540
Blade Sharpening $15–$40 $25–$75 $40–$120
Emergency Service $180–$300 $200–$600 $300–$900

Maintenance Frequency & Pro Tune-Up Checklist

Your mower doesn’t need constant babysitting—just timely care.

  • Most homeowners: one full service per year (usually in spring).
  • Heavy users: service at roughly 25 operating hours.
  • Commercial crews: follow the 25-hour rule monthly during peak season.

A professional tune-up typically covers:

  • Spark plug replacement
  • Air-filter cleaning or swap
  • Oil change
  • Belt inspection and adjustment
  • Deck leveling and blade sharpening

Skipping any of these invites the dreaded Saturday-morning breakdown.

DIY vs. Pro: When to Call Lawn Mower Services Near Me

Handle simple jobs—air filters, fresh fuel, blade swaps—yourself. Call a pro for:

  • Persistent engine stalls
  • Uneven cuts after you’ve checked blade sharpness
  • Smoke of any color
  • No-start issues on newer, warrantied equipment

Wrong guesses here can void warranties and cost more than a service call.

Seasonal Storage & Eco-Friendly Options

Winterizing protects your investment. A good shop will:

  • Add stabilizer or drain fuel
  • Test, charge, and store batteries correctly
  • Recycle oil and other fluids responsibly

Battery-powered mowers need brush, connection, and software checks—services most local technicians now provide.

How often should I book a full mower service?

The simple answer is once a year for most residential mowers, but your actual needs depend on how much you use your equipment. If you’re mowing weekly during the growing season, your mower is working hard and deserves that annual professional attention.

Here’s what works for most people: spring tune-ups get your mower ready for the busy season ahead, while fall service prepares everything for winter storage and prevents those frustrating fuel system problems that pop up after months of sitting idle.

For folks who really put their mowers through their paces – think large properties or commercial use – you might want to consider service every 25-50 operating hours. That sounds like a lot, but it’s really about keeping ahead of problems before they turn into expensive repairs.

Many local providers offer package deals that bundle spring and fall service together, which can save you money and ensure your mower gets the attention it needs year-round.
